Output 16db6e6fbdabca838df4aecd65ed006ea50822ca71877091239dcd4b7bf71e5e:0

value
1014454038
script pubkey
OP_0 OP_PUSHBYTES_20 aa8e21ba1c8eca363666da549f494108262eaca4
address
bc1q428zrwsu3m9rvdnxmf2f7j2ppqnzat9yxahf2k
transaction
16db6e6fbdabca838df4aecd65ed006ea50822ca71877091239dcd4b7bf71e5e
confirmations
379539
spent
true